I've been doing some light reading

A couple of months ago, I won these three novels in a give-away on Cindy's Fluffy Sheep Quilting blog.


It took a while from them to arrive from Ireland but they got here safely.

They are detective stories set in a small town in New York. The central characters are the quilting circle at Someday Quilts; specifically the owner of the shop, Eleanor, and her adult grand-daughter, Nell.

I have finished the first of the three books. I couldn't put it down so finished it in just a few hours. The ending was a surprise to me - I certainly didn't see it coming.

Those who read the post on my TV viewing habits will know that I am a fan of detective/crime shows.

This book is a combination of detective story woven around Nell's quilting journey - what's not to love? LOL
